try this
AT <enter>
AT+CPMS="ME" <enter>
AT+CMGF=1 <enter>
AT+CMGL="ALL" <enter>

tell us what you receive.

hi,
i m also working on the similar project. i m trying to sens sms by interfacing microcontoller (8051) with NOKIA 6080 .. i m using AT COMMANDS.
i m able to send sms when i connect nokia 6080 with pc serial port and then send AT commands through hyperterminal.... i just send ... AT+CMGS="9865682569"message....with this i was successfully able to send sms.....
i have written program for the same in 8051....but when i connect my 8051 with 6080 ... i do not get any response.....
when i connect 8051 circuit (serial port o/p) with pc then i m able to see the AT commands that r send by 8051 on hyperterminal.... the commands appear without any error.....

i m using DKU-5 cable which has RS-232 o/p on one side......

plz... tell me where is the mistake....

also regarding post send by ABBAS1707...... i want to how much delay is there in the delay() function for the code below posted by ABBAS1707....
is it 1ms....
CODE:
void main()
{
        initUART();
        delay();
        sendString("AT+CMGF=1");  // command to select text mode
        sendChar(13);
        delay();
        sendString("AT+CMGS=\"0999999999\"");// here 09999999999 is recepient's number
        sendChar(13);
        delay();
        sendString("Hello!");  // Hello! will be sent
        sendChar(26);
        sendChar(13);          
}
